In a remarkable development for the Solana community, Solana validators have successfully completed an upgrade to version 1.14. This groundbreaking move signifies a monumental stride towards the network’s commitment to performance improvement, scalability, and security, further solidifying Solana’s position as a promising player in the blockchain industry.

The Solana Foundation, the entity behind the fast-rising, high-performance blockchain, announced this upgrade in a recent blog post. The upgrade ushers in a host of improvements expected to bolster the network’s performance, including memory usage, signature verification speed, and overall system stability.

What is pivotal to this upgrade is its commitment to improving memory usage. The Solana team identified this as a significant challenge that could potentially hinder the network’s high-speed performance. The team has taken strides in addressing this issue, and the update includes enhanced features to provide a more efficient and robust network.

The upgrade also introduces improvements to signature verification speed, a critical factor in achieving quick transaction times. Faster signature verification is one of the reasons why Solana has become a preferred choice for developers looking to build fast, scalable applications.

Moreover, in line with its dedication to security, Solana has also included a new feature in the upgrade – the integration of Cloudfare’s Roughtime for more accurate timestamping. This feature is designed to ensure the correctness of timestamps on transactions, increasing the overall security and trustworthiness of the network.

The validator community was essential in this upgrade process. Before the deployment, Solana ran extensive simulations and stress tests on the update in a beta testnet environment. The feedback from the validator community was invaluable and allowed Solana to improve and refine the upgrade before rolling it out to the mainnet.
